I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

VBScript Discussion :

Variable dans balise programme HTA


Sujet :

VBScript

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re éclairé
    Homme Profil pro
    retraité
    Inscrit en
    Juillet 2011
    Messages
    386
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 80
    Localisation : France, Pas de Calais (Nord Pas de Calais)

    Informations professionnelles :
    Activité : retraité

    Informations forums :
    Inscription : Juillet 2011
    Messages : 386
    Par défaut Variable dans balise programme HTA
    Bonjour
    je voudrais mettre une variable (px) dans une balise <div> du paramètre "top" dans le style.
    Cela est-t-il possible?
    Si oui, comment procéder. Merci

  2. #2
    Expert confirmé
    Avatar de hackoofr
    Homme Profil pro
    Enseignant
    Inscrit en
    Juin 2009
    Messages
    3 844
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 50
    Localisation : Tunisie

    Informations professionnelles :
    Activité : Enseignant

    Informations forums :
    Inscription : Juin 2009
    Messages : 3 844
    Par défaut

    ça sera plus explicite si vous postiez la portion du code qui vous pose ce problème et comme d'habitude
    @+

  3. #3
    Membre éclairé
    Homme Profil pro
    retraité
    Inscrit en
    Juillet 2011
    Messages
    386
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 80
    Localisation : France, Pas de Calais (Nord Pas de Calais)

    Informations professionnelles :
    Activité : retraité

    Informations forums :
    Inscription : Juillet 2011
    Messages : 386
    Par défaut
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
                         
    <div style='position: absolute; left: 0px; top: %tpx;'>
    <input type='text' name='nomjpg' style='width: 650px;' disabled=true>
    <input type="button" value="Quitter" onclick=fin>
    </div>
    %t étant la variable dans cet exemple.
    En fait, je voudrais que la ligne texte et le bouton viennent en bas de la fenêtre.

  4. #4
    Expert confirmé
    Avatar de hackoofr
    Homme Profil pro
    Enseignant
    Inscrit en
    Juin 2009
    Messages
    3 844
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 50
    Localisation : Tunisie

    Informations professionnelles :
    Activité : Enseignant

    Informations forums :
    Inscription : Juin 2009
    Messages : 3 844
    Par défaut
    En fait, je voudrais que la ligne texte et le bouton viennent en bas de la fenêtre
    Pas assez clair, quelle fenêtre ? si votre code n'est pas assez long poster le en entier

  5. #5
    Membre éclairé
    Homme Profil pro
    retraité
    Inscrit en
    Juillet 2011
    Messages
    386
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 80
    Localisation : France, Pas de Calais (Nord Pas de Calais)

    Informations professionnelles :
    Activité : retraité

    Informations forums :
    Inscription : Juillet 2011
    Messages : 386
    Par défaut
    la fenêtre est celle qui est ouverte par le programme.

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    sub window_onload
            maxh = window.screen.availHeight
    	window.moveTo    40,0  
            window.resizeTo 800,maxh
     nomjpg.value=maxh
             lire_fic
    end sub
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    </script> <body      bgcolor='#FFE4C4' >
    <SELECT NAME='lstDyn' size=37 onchange='options' > </SELECT><br>
    <TEXTAREA NAME='txtCommentaires' ID='resu' ROWS='13'
           style='width: 780px;background-color :transparent;border:none'
                         readonly>   </TEXTAREA>
    <div  style='position: absolute; left: 450px; top: 10px;'>
      <input type='text' name='genr'
           style='width: 250px;background-color :transparent;
                  border:none;text-align:center;'    readonly><br><br>
     <img id='imag' name='imag' src='' width='300' height='190'
           style=border='0' alt=''>
    </div>
     
    <div ID='dl' style='position: absolute; left: 0px;'>
    <input type='text' name='nomjpg' style='width: 650px;' disabled=true>
    <input type="button" value="Quitter" onclick=fin>
    </div> </body>

  6. #6
    Expert confirmé
    Avatar de ProgElecT
    Homme Profil pro
    Retraité
    Inscrit en
    Décembre 2004
    Messages
    6 130
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 69
    Localisation : France, Haute Savoie (Rhône Alpes)

    Informations professionnelles :
    Activité : Retraité
    Secteur : Communication - Médias

    Informations forums :
    Inscription : Décembre 2004
    Messages : 6 130
    Par défaut
    Salut

    Un exemple sans reprendre exactement ton code
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
    22
    23
    24
    25
    26
    27
    28
    29
    <TITLE> Un exemple</TITLE>
    <HTA:APPLICATION
    		applicationname="Essais"
    		version="1"
     		MAXIMIZEBUTTON="no"
    		SCROLL="no"
    		BORDER = "thin" >
     
     </HEAD>
    <script language="VBScript">
    ' Déclarations utilisables dans toute la partie VBScript
    	Dim TP
    '----------------------------------------------------------------------------------------------------------------------
    	Sub Window_Onload()
    	TP = 15
    	End Sub
    '----------------------------------------------------------------------------------------------------------------------
    	Sub MouseoverOn() 'la souris commence a passer au dessus de l'objet
    	Archi.Style.top = TP
    	End Sub
    '----------------------------------------------------------------------------------------------------------------------
    	Sub MouseoutOn() 'la souris quitte l'objet
    	Archi.Style.top = 10
    	End Sub
    </SCRIPT>
    <body>
    			<Div Id="Archi"  style="font-weight:normal; color:#000000; position:absolute; left:10px; top:10px; height:22px" 
    			onmouseover="MouseoverOn" onmouseout="MouseoutOn"> Démonstration </Div>
    </body>
    Le mot Démonstration passe à Top valeur de la variable TP au passage de la souris sur le Div et revient à 10 Px quand la souris n'est plus dessus, tous autres événement pourrait convenir (Window_onUnLoad() ?? ...... ).
    :whistle:pourquoi pas, pour remercier, un :plusser: pour celui/ceux qui vous ont dépannés.
    saut de ligne
    OOOOOOOOO👉 → → Ma page perso sur DVP ← ← 👈

Discussions similaires

  1. [HTA] Navigation dans un programme hta
    Par olivierm67 dans le forum VBScript
    Réponses: 10
    Dernier message: 21/02/2013, 16h30
  2. Réponses: 33
    Dernier message: 28/04/2010, 04h44
  3. Réponses: 4
    Dernier message: 01/04/2010, 15h20
  4. Réponses: 4
    Dernier message: 14/04/2009, 14h12
  5. Réponses: 8
    Dernier message: 23/03/2006, 19h30

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o